Q1. What does the gauge bar at the top of the screen mean?
A: The top bar is a gauge that goes up based on player 'noise'. It fills up from all sounds generated inside the mansion—including voice input via your microphone, footstep sounds from walking or running, and even the ducks' "Quack!" sounds.
Q2. Does the noise gauge ever go down?
A: Yes! The noise gauge goes down over time. However, the rate at which it drops varies depending on the difficulty you select at the start of the game.
Q3. Why do Grandma’s appearance and behavior keep changing?
A: Grandma’s 'Threat Level' rises as your noise gauge fills up. Higher threat levels cause her appearance and behavior patterns to shift. Once the accumulated noise gauge reaches Level 3, Grandma undergoes an even more grotesque transformation and becomes far more sensitive to sound.
Q4. Why does Grandma still catch me after I take cover in a hiding spot?
A: If you were within Grandma's line of sight right before entering the hiding spot, she will still detect you even if you hide inside. You must hide only when you are completely out of her line of sight to stay safe!
Q5. Why do I get caught by Grandma more easily and frequently as the game progresses?
A: This happens because both Grandma's vision and hearing improve as the noise gauge level starts to climb. While she’s more sensitive to sound than sight, at noise level 3 she’ll spot you instantly—even if you’re hiding under a bed with just a toe sticking out or you make the slightest noise, so be extra careful.
